Cloud hosting has revolutionized the way businesses and individuals manage their online presence. Unlike traditional hosting methods, which rely on a single server, cloud hosting utilizes a network of interconnected servers that work together to provide resources and services. This innovative approach allows for greater flexibility, scalability, and reliability, making it an attractive option for organizations of all sizes.
The cloud infrastructure can dynamically allocate resources based on demand, ensuring that websites and applications remain responsive even during peak traffic periods. The rise of cloud hosting can be attributed to the increasing need for businesses to adapt to a rapidly changing digital landscape. As companies expand their online operations, they require hosting solutions that can grow with them.
Cloud hosting meets this demand by offering a pay-as-you-go model, where users only pay for the resources they consume. This model not only reduces upfront costs but also allows businesses to allocate their budgets more effectively, investing in growth rather than infrastructure.
Key Takeaways
- Cloud hosting offers scalability, flexibility, and improved security for websites.
- Load balancing and geographic redundancy ensure faster loading times and enhanced uptime.
- Cloud hosting is cost-effective and allows for seamless integration with content delivery networks.
- Advanced monitoring and analytics help future-proof websites and optimize performance.
- Cloud hosting provides the infrastructure needed for a successful and reliable website.
Scalability and Flexibility
One of the most significant advantages of cloud hosting is its inherent scalability. Businesses can easily scale their resources up or down based on their current needs without the constraints of physical hardware. For instance, an e-commerce site may experience a surge in traffic during holiday sales or promotional events.
With cloud hosting, the site can automatically allocate additional resources to handle the increased load, ensuring a seamless shopping experience for customers. Conversely, during slower periods, businesses can reduce their resource allocation, optimizing costs without sacrificing performance. Flexibility is another hallmark of cloud hosting.
Organizations can choose from various configurations and services tailored to their specific requirements. Whether it’s selecting the right operating system, database management system, or application stack, cloud hosting providers offer a range of options that allow businesses to customize their environments. This adaptability extends to deployment models as well; companies can opt for public, private, or hybrid cloud solutions based on their security and compliance needs.
Such versatility empowers businesses to innovate and respond to market changes swiftly.
Load Balancing
Load balancing is a critical component of cloud hosting that enhances performance and reliability. By distributing incoming traffic across multiple servers, load balancers ensure that no single server becomes overwhelmed with requests. This distribution not only improves response times but also enhances the overall user experience.
For example, a popular news website may receive thousands of visitors simultaneously during breaking news events. A load balancer can intelligently route traffic to various servers, preventing any one server from becoming a bottleneck. Moreover, load balancing contributes to fault tolerance in cloud environments.
If one server fails or experiences issues, the load balancer can redirect traffic to healthy servers, minimizing downtime and maintaining service availability. This capability is particularly crucial for businesses that rely on their online presence for revenue generation. By implementing effective load balancing strategies, organizations can ensure that their applications remain accessible and performant, even under challenging conditions.
Geographic Redundancy
Geographic redundancy is another vital feature of cloud hosting that enhances reliability and disaster recovery capabilities. By distributing data across multiple data centers located in different geographic regions, cloud providers can ensure that data remains accessible even in the event of localized outages or natural disasters. For instance, if a data center in one region experiences a power failure or severe weather conditions, users can still access their applications and data from another data center unaffected by the incident.
This redundancy not only safeguards against data loss but also improves latency for users in different regions. By serving content from the nearest data center, cloud hosting providers can deliver faster response times and enhance the overall user experience. Businesses with a global customer base can particularly benefit from this feature, as it allows them to provide consistent performance regardless of where their users are located.
Geographic redundancy thus plays a crucial role in ensuring business continuity and maintaining customer satisfaction.
Improved Security
Security is a paramount concern for any organization operating online, and cloud hosting offers several features designed to enhance data protection. Leading cloud providers invest heavily in security measures such as encryption, firewalls, and intrusion detection systems to safeguard sensitive information. For example, data stored in the cloud can be encrypted both at rest and in transit, ensuring that unauthorized parties cannot access it even if they intercept the data.
Additionally, cloud hosting providers often comply with industry standards and regulations such as GDPR, HIPAA, and PCI DSS. This compliance not only helps businesses meet legal requirements but also instills confidence in customers regarding the safety of their data. Furthermore, many cloud providers offer advanced security features like multi-factor authentication (MFA) and identity management solutions that help organizations control access to their resources effectively.
By leveraging these security measures, businesses can mitigate risks and protect themselves against potential cyber threats.
Faster Loading Times
Enhancing Loading Speeds with Cloud Hosting
Cloud hosting significantly enhances loading speeds through its distributed architecture and content delivery capabilities. By utilizing multiple servers across various locations, cloud hosting can serve content from the nearest server to the user, reducing latency and improving load times.
Optimizing Content Delivery with Cloud Hosting
For instance, a user accessing a website hosted on a cloud platform from Europe will receive content from a European data center rather than one located in North America. Moreover, many cloud hosting providers integrate with Content Delivery Networks (CDNs), which further optimize content delivery by caching static assets closer to users. This integration allows for quicker access to images, videos, and other media files essential for an engaging user experience.
The Impact of Loading Times on Conversion Rates
As studies have shown that even a one-second delay in loading time can lead to significant drops in conversion rates, leveraging cloud hosting’s speed advantages is crucial for businesses aiming to maximize their online performance.
Enhanced Uptime
Uptime is a critical metric for any online service; even minor outages can lead to lost revenue and damage to brand reputation. Cloud hosting excels in providing enhanced uptime through its redundant infrastructure and failover mechanisms. With multiple servers working together in a cloud environment, if one server goes down, others can take over seamlessly without disrupting service availability.
This redundancy ensures that websites and applications remain operational even during hardware failures or maintenance activities. Many cloud hosting providers guarantee high uptime percentages—often exceeding 99.9%—through Service Level Agreements (SLAs). These agreements outline the provider’s commitment to maintaining service availability and often include compensation clauses for customers if uptime falls below specified thresholds.
By choosing a reliable cloud hosting provider with robust uptime guarantees, businesses can minimize disruptions and maintain continuous access to their services.
Cost-Effectiveness
Cost-effectiveness is one of the primary reasons organizations are increasingly turning to cloud hosting solutions. Traditional hosting models often require significant upfront investments in hardware and infrastructure, along with ongoing maintenance costs. In contrast, cloud hosting operates on a pay-as-you-go model that allows businesses to pay only for the resources they use.
This flexibility enables organizations to allocate their budgets more efficiently while avoiding unnecessary expenditures on unused capacity. Additionally, cloud hosting eliminates the need for extensive IT staff dedicated solely to managing physical servers and infrastructure. With many routine maintenance tasks handled by the cloud provider—such as software updates and security patches—businesses can redirect their IT resources toward strategic initiatives that drive growth and innovation.
The combination of reduced capital expenditures and lower operational costs makes cloud hosting an attractive option for organizations looking to optimize their financial resources.
Advanced Monitoring and Analytics
Cloud hosting platforms often come equipped with advanced monitoring and analytics tools that provide valuable insights into application performance and user behavior. These tools enable businesses to track key performance indicators (KPIs) such as response times, error rates, and resource utilization in real-time. For example, an e-commerce site can monitor its checkout process to identify bottlenecks that may be causing cart abandonment.
Furthermore, these analytics tools allow organizations to make data-driven decisions regarding resource allocation and optimization strategies. By analyzing traffic patterns and user interactions, businesses can adjust their infrastructure proactively to meet changing demands or improve user experiences. The ability to leverage advanced monitoring capabilities empowers organizations to enhance their operational efficiency while ensuring that they remain responsive to customer needs.
Seamless Integration with Content Delivery Networks (CDN)
The integration of cloud hosting with Content Delivery Networks (CDNs) is another significant advantage that enhances performance and user experience. CDNs consist of a network of distributed servers strategically located around the globe that cache content closer to end-users. When combined with cloud hosting solutions, CDNs enable faster content delivery by reducing latency associated with long-distance data transmission.
For instance, when a user requests a video hosted on a cloud platform integrated with a CDN, the request is routed to the nearest CDN server rather than the original source server. This not only speeds up loading times but also reduces bandwidth consumption on the primary server by offloading traffic to the CDN network. As a result, businesses can provide high-quality content delivery while optimizing resource usage—a crucial factor for maintaining competitive advantage in today’s digital landscape.
Future-Proofing Your Website
As technology continues to evolve at an unprecedented pace, future-proofing your website becomes essential for long-term success. Cloud hosting offers a robust foundation that allows businesses to adapt quickly to emerging trends and technologies without significant disruptions or overhauls of existing infrastructure. With its inherent scalability and flexibility, organizations can easily incorporate new features or services as they become available.
For example, as artificial intelligence (AI) and machine learning (ML) technologies gain traction across various industries, businesses leveraging cloud hosting can seamlessly integrate these capabilities into their applications without needing extensive hardware upgrades or migrations. This adaptability ensures that organizations remain competitive in an ever-changing digital landscape while minimizing risks associated with technological obsolescence. In conclusion, cloud hosting presents numerous advantages that cater to the diverse needs of modern businesses.
From scalability and flexibility to enhanced security measures and cost-effectiveness, it provides an ideal solution for organizations looking to optimize their online presence while preparing for future challenges.
FAQs
What is cloud hosting?
Cloud hosting is a type of web hosting service that uses multiple virtual servers to host websites and applications. It allows for the resources of multiple servers to be used as needed, providing scalability and reliability.
How does cloud hosting enhance website performance?
Cloud hosting enhances website performance by distributing the load across multiple servers, which can handle traffic spikes and ensure consistent uptime. It also allows for easy scalability, so resources can be added or removed as needed to meet demand.
What performance enhancement techniques are used in cloud hosting?
Performance enhancement techniques used in cloud hosting include load balancing, which distributes traffic across multiple servers, and caching, which stores frequently accessed data to reduce load times. Additionally, content delivery networks (CDNs) can be used to deliver content from servers located closer to the user, reducing latency.
What are the benefits of using cloud hosting for website performance?
The benefits of using cloud hosting for website performance include improved scalability, reliability, and uptime. It also allows for better resource utilization and cost efficiency, as resources can be allocated as needed. Additionally, cloud hosting offers better security and disaster recovery options.